Firm to stage major city events proposed to the city council

Advertisements

 

EVENTS such as “Foods of Garden Grove Live” could be organized by an Anaheim firm under a contract proposed to the Garden Grove City Council (file photo).

Garden Grove could be getting more fun.

At Wednesday’s meeting the Garden Grove City Council will consider a contract for special services for events such as Winter in the Grove and Foods of Garden Grove Live.

The contract would be for an amount not to exceed $200,000 annually. The chosen vendor is James Event Productions, based in Anaheim.

According to its website, its experience includes a wide variety of types, including company picnics, events and festivals, catering, kids rides, “spectacular rides,” attractions (including a mechanical bull), inflatable rides, booth games and a variety of entertainment.

The company would be responsible for managing all logistical and operational aspects, although other vendors could also be used by the city.

The agreement would be for an initial one-year term with the option to extend the agreement for up to four additional one-year terms.

The council will meet at 6:30 p.m. on Wednesday in the Community Meeting Center, 11300 Stanford Ave. The meeting was moved from Tuesday because of observance of Veteran’s Day.
